Skip Navigation

Science & Innovation Policy

Definitions

List of terms for Technology Transfer.

Developing countries are increasingly recognising the importance of science in developing their economies, and the challenges that entails.

S

Small and medium-sized enterprises (SME)

An independent company with fewer than 250 employees (ECC).

Spin-off/spin-out

A company established to commercialise the knowledge and skills of a university or corporate research team (ECC).

Start-up

A newly formed company usually based around a novel product or process (ECC).

Systemic model of innovation

A model of innovation process based on an awareness that successful innovation depends on interactions between many individuals, organisations and environmental factors. Within this model, research and development is no longer viewed as the 'source' of innovation but as one of a number of essential elements (ECC).